QUARTERLY PLANNING NOTE — For the incoming director

Hiring freeze in the Merrowfield Tooling division holds through Q3. Open requisitions cancelled except two safety-critical roles approved by Halden. Attrition backfills require VP sign-off. Contractor spend capped at current run rate. Freeze review set for the October planning cycle. The rationale ties to the strategic position summarized immediately below.

board note of fahag-tajop: The eastern region missed its Julix quota by 44.0 percent last quarter. Ralionax Holdings plans to lower the Druath list price by 61.8 percent in March. The board signed off on a budget of $295.0 million for Project Gilath. The renewal with Ruswynix Systems closes at $274.5 million a year, 17.0 percent above the last contract.

Hey — handing off the Inkpost spooler before I'm out. It's stable, but the retry queue backs up if the render workers restart mid-job; just drain and requeue. Dashboards cover the rest. New folks: the one thing worth memorizing is the service config, which currently looks like this.

deployment values, yadug-bawif:
[framir]
team = pelox
access_code = ac_a38ab2
owner = tamion.julael
host = framir.tolvaqlabs.test
port = 11211
peer = tammir.zemvargrid.local
salt = 2215ef03
pin = 1541

Subject: Handover — Brimway broker upgrade

Welcome aboard. Broker upgrade from Brimway 4 to 5 is mid-flight. Canary nodes converted last week; consumer lag normal. Remaining: flip the Oxhall cluster Thursday, then decommission the old quorum nodes. Rollback plan is in the runbook — read it before Thursday, not during. Don't touch topic retention settings until after cutover. Deploys to the broker fleet go through the signed-release pipeline only. You'll need the fleet deploy key, which is provided below.

signing key of bagap-yawep = bky13_TbfT6ZMUoGJo2

Handover — Grindlewood ORM refactor

Hey, passing the Grindlewood ORM refactor to you ahead of the release. The legacy mapper in `corelib` is gone; everything now routes through the new adapter layer Priya and I built. Query behavior should be identical, but watch the batch-write paths — those were hairiest. Feature flag stays on in staging for one more cycle. For the release notes, the adapter's current settings are listed below.

config for yajep-tafof:
[rusath]
team = julmir
access_code = ac_fe37fd
host = rusath.novactech.test
port = 8000
owner = pelmir.weneth
peer = oliwyn.olvarqdyn.internal